Particle Segregation Testing Instrument

Segregation, or separation, of granular powder materials is one of the main causes of process failure with systems that handle powder materials. Using state-of-the-art spectroscopic technology, the innovative SPECTester is capable of analyzing a sample comprised of up to six individual components, such as: particle size, sifting, fluidization, angle of repose, chemical component and air entrainment.

SPECTester Material Segregation Tester uses state-of-the-art spectroscopic technology and is  capable of analyzing a sample comprised of up to six individual components and provides a simple report indicating why and how much the sample material is segregating. Fully automated, the instrument provides data about component concentrations, particle size differences, and product uniformity. 

The SPECTester can be used in R&D environments to research a materials properties prior to going into production as well as in production plants for real-time quality control.
